You are missing something. Do yourself a favor and educate yourself; read my player statistics on page 7 of the Montana recruits thread.

Jace was a SB, not WR. So in addition to his 560 rec yards and 8 TDs on 20 catches ...Jace Klucewich ran for an additional 862 yards and 17 TDs from the LOS.

Small kid, but has JLM speed, quickness and toughness.

Good Big Sky Conf type player.
 
I would be very surprised if MWC offered.

MWC never offered JLM.

Jace and Jerry have near identicle PR speed (very, very good, but not elite).

Jerry 11.07
Jace 11.06

(with 2 track seasons to try and improve for Jace)

I'd love for the Griz to land Jace. He will be facing faster competition in AA than he did in A, but he will still be great!! Stud.
